Unlocking Design Potential: PDF to CAD Conversion transforming
In the realm of design and engineering, seamless integration between diverse file formats is paramount. Preserving the accuracy and fidelity of intricate designs often hinges on converting files from one format to another. PDF documents, renowned for their readability and widespread accessibility, can sometimes miss the specific attributes needed in CAD software for precise drafting and modeling. This is where a powerful tool like PDF to CAD conversion comes into play, revealing new dimensions of design potential.
By leveraging advanced algorithms and intelligent recognition techniques, PDF to CAD conversion tools can accurately extract the vector-based geometry embedded within PDFs. This process translates the static representations in PDFs into editable CAD files, empowering designers and engineers to adjust existing designs or create new ones with unparalleled precision. The emerging CAD files can then be seamlessly integrated into design workflows, enabling efficient collaboration, prototyping, and production.
Bridging the Gap: Integrating CAD, BIM, and PDF
The construction field is rapidly evolving, with new technologies constantly emerging to improve design and partnership. One key area of focus is integrating different software platforms, such as Computer-Aided Design (CAD), Building Information Modeling (BIM), and Portable Document Format (PDF). This combination can significantly simplify workflows and enhance project outcomes.
Historically, these platforms have operated in isolation, leading to redundancy of effort and potential communication gaps. By connecting this gap, stakeholders can utilize a shared platform that provides a comprehensive perspective of the project from conception to completion.
This integrated approach offers numerous advantages, including:
- Improved accuracy and consistency in design documentation
- Reduced time and cost related with project delivery
- Enhanced communication and collaboration among team members
- Better decision-making based on comprehensive data insights
The adoption of this integrated ecosystem is crucial for realizing the full potential of modern construction practices.
